小编Pox*_*xac的帖子

使用连接表进行查询带来错误的 ID - Laravel

这真让我抓狂。

\n\n

我有两个表:记录和用户以及一个带用户记录的查询:

\n\n
$records = Record::with(\'user\')\n        ->join(\'users\', \'users.id\', \'=\', \'records.user_id\')\n        ->orderBy(\'users.name\', \'asc\')\n        ->where(\'schedule_id\', $schedule->id)\n        ->get();\n
Run Code Online (Sandbox Code Playgroud)\n\n

dd($records);给我带来了这个:

\n\n
Collection {#827 \xe2\x96\xbc\n    #items: array:6 [\xe2\x96\xbc\n        0 => Record {#773 \xe2\x96\xbc\n            #connection: "mysql"\n            #table: null\n            #primaryKey: "id"\n            #keyType: "int"\n            +incrementing: true\n            #with: []\n            #withCount: []\n            #perPage: 15\n            +exists: true\n            +wasRecentlyCreated: false\n            #attributes: array:13 [\xe2\x96\xbc\n                "id" => 26\n                "user_id" => 26\n                "schedule_id" => 3\n                "start_time" => "12:00"\n                "end_time" => "20:00"\n                "created_at" => null\n                "updated_at" => null\n                "name" => "Ali Fay"\n …
Run Code Online (Sandbox Code Playgroud)

laravel laravel-5

2
推荐指数
1
解决办法
3004
查看次数

转换为 Blade+Laravel 一个 while 循环

这段代码有效,但是在我学习Laravel的过程中,我想知道是否使用Blade+Laravel语法,可以更好地实现

<?php
    $i = 1;
    while ($i <= (5 - $post->images->count())) {
        echo '<div class="col"> </div>';
        $i++;
    }
    ?>
Run Code Online (Sandbox Code Playgroud)

谢谢

laravel blade

0
推荐指数
1
解决办法
8215
查看次数

标签 统计

laravel ×2

blade ×1

laravel-5 ×1